THERE will be a grand day out for all the family at Tendring Primary School’s Summer Fete this Saturday.

The school will be opening its doors from 12pm until 4pm to raise money for extra educational experiences and opportunities for its pupils.

Friends of Tendring School has organised the event at the School Road site with pupil’s preparing to showcase their singing, dancing and musical skills at the Tendring’s Got Talent fete finale.

With World Cup fever sweeping the nation, junior Gerrards can show off their football skills under the tutelage of former Colchester United captain Kem Izzet.

Youngsters can also try out an assault course, boot camp and archery and there will be performances by cheerleaders and a dance company, as well as the usual favourite fete stalls.

A spokesman for Friends of Tendring School said: “All the money raised from the summer fete goes to funding additional experiences and opportunities for the children.

“This enhances the education they receive and makes their school lives so amazing.”

Admission is 50p for adults and free for children.
